I have a nice server with its timezone set to Europe/Amsterdam (DST
enabled). Everything works fine except for one thing. In winter, system
time is always correct. When going into DST, the clock adjusts itself
and again time is correct. However when I shutdown my server right
now, and boot it up again, the clock is 1 hour behind - just as if the
DST change is forgotten. As this server is also time server for the rest
of my net, it's double trouble as all clocks are starting to run slow.
How can I solve this?
